Academy Governance

The HOD as the voice of members governs the profession and develops policy on major professional issues.

The Academy Board of Directors governs the Academy Staff.

The Academy staff implements decisions.

Spring 2015: Mega Issue

Academy Corporate Sponsorship(Malnutrition deferred to Fall 2015)

•Kraft Singles Kids Eat Right

•Membership Issue Question:How do we evolve our existing

sponsorship program to further the mission, vision and goals of the Academy

while safeguarding the Academy’s reputation and integrity?

Spring HOD Meeting Objectives

1. Understand the impact of sponsorship program on the profession, Academy Foundation, and the Academy, including DPGs, MIGs, Affiliates.

2. Identify the Academy’s steps in evaluating alignment with a potential sponsor.

3. Identify elements of the Academy’s corporate sponsorship program that need to be retained or modified.

Sponsorship Motion

Guiding principles identified and actions needed:1.A full report of the effects of sponsorship by September 1, 20152.Strategic communications plan to all members-clear/concise; solicit input from HOD when evaluating potential sponsors.3.Transparency with sponsorship details ($$ received, allocation of $$, commitments, etc). Web page and annual report TBD.

Sponsorship Motion-Continued

4. Sponsorship guidelines to include:- no logos- no endorsements- sponsor products consistent with EB

nutrition guidelines- opportunities for smaller companies- support/promote healthy eating, vision

and mission, goals of the Academy- full disclosure on sponsorship agreements-all DPGs, MIGs, etc to abide by guidelines
